Can I put this barrel ext. on my 16 inch h-bar bushmaster barrel? (currently wearing a standard ext)

http://www.lewismachine.net/product.php?p=124&cid=12&session=9675b85ae8c6dcad9e1c9eceed3fab28

Is this setup an "upgrade" compared to standard rifle feed ramps?  (m4 ext, with a non m4 upper reciver?)

The rifle/ barrel has had 1700 rounds thought it, if I was able to put an m4 bbl ext in my barrel, would there be any headspace issues?

It it worth it, if the time/cost of putting the m4 ext was a non-issue?

I was LUCKY once.  I'd not intentionally try this process ever again, unless there was some unavoidable situation that absolutely required me to.

If you really, really, really want extended ramps, you can Dremel them in, like some do (some better than others).  I'd get the proper receiver with factory machined and anodized
ramps and Dremel the present extension to proper spec, but that's just me.
